I am the network administrator of a French high school. I have already
configured a BIND9 server with dynamic DNS update from the ISC DHCP
server for my zone :
lyc-guillaume-fichet.ac-grenoble.fr
And I would like to add a samba4 server in this zone. How can I add
the samba's DNS entries to this existing zone keeping my previous
static and dynamic entries ?
I can't use directly the SAMBA_DLZ module because it try to create a
new zone of same name so the bind server won't start anymore.
It is possible to rename the samba DLZ zone and forward the unknown
entries of my zone lyc-guillaume-fichet.ac-grenoble.fr to the samba
DLZ database ?
It is possible to add manually the samba DNS entries ? (I don't really
need the kerberos dynamic DNS because the DHCP server do this job)
What is the best way to do this working ?
